Rates & Terms

Equipment financing rates in Franconia are often 1-2% lower than unsecured loans because the equipment serves as collateral.

Business lines of credit in Franconia range from 8% to 24% APR, with interest charged only on drawn amounts.

Requirements in Franconia

Startups in Franconia may qualify for SBA microloans up to $50,000 or community development loans with less stringent requirements.

Traditional business lenders in Franconia typically require 2+ years in business, $100,000+ annual revenue, and a personal credit score of 680+.

Borrowing Tips for Franconia

  • Avoid merchant cash advances unless absolutely necessary; the effective APR can exceed 100% on short-term products.
  • Consider an SBA loan for larger amounts and longer terms; the government guarantee reduces lender risk and improves your rate.
  • Maintain a cash reserve equal to 3-6 months of operating expenses; lenders view this as a sign of financial stability.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the best type of business loan for a startup in Franconia?

SBA microloans, community development financial institutions, and equipment financing are often the best options for startups lacking the 2-year history banks require.

How much can I borrow for my business in VA?

SBA 7(a) loans max at $5 million. Traditional bank loans in Franconia typically range from $25,000 to $500,000. Online lenders may offer $5,000 to $250,000.

Can I get a business loan with bad credit?

Yes, but expect higher rates and shorter terms. Consider revenue-based financing, invoice factoring, or finding a creditworthy co-signer to improve your offer.

Do I need collateral for a business loan in Franconia?

SBA and traditional bank loans typically require collateral. Unsecured business loans and lines of credit are available but carry higher rates and lower limits.
